GCL Technology Holdings’s Stock Price Soars to 1.45 HKD, Witnessing a Robust 3.57% Uptick

By November 29, 2024 No Comments

GCL Technology Holdings (3800)

1.45 HKD +0.05 (+3.57%) Volume: 403.29M

GCL Technology Holdings’s stock price sees a remarkable surge, trading at 1.45 HKD with an impressive session increase of +3.57% and a substantial trading volume of 403.29M. The stock continues its positive streak with a Year-to-Date (YTD) percentage change of +16.94%, solidifying its robust performance in the market.

Gcl Poly Energy Holdings Limited, a Chinese power company specializing in solar grade polysilicon production and operating cogeneration plants in China, is positioned for continued success based on its Smartkarma Smart Scores.
